From Chevy website:
Thundering 345 horsepower @ 5200 rpm
HEMI-beating 380 lb.-ft. of torque @ 4000 rpm(1)
10,000 lbs. of towing capacity(1) — the most towing capacity of any half-ton pickup on the road(1)
Vortec Max V8 Engine Features:
More horsepower than Ford, Toyota, and Nissan half-ton pickups(2)
More torque and trailering capacity than a Dodge HEMI(2)
Vortec Max Performance Pack(3) includes Ride Control Suspension, a 9.5-inch axle, automatic locking rear differential, and a Heavy-Duty Trailering Package.
Deep inside the combustion chamber of Vortec engines, a ferocious vortex is created to generate a better fuel-to-air mixture.
A high-capacity cast-iron crankshaft with undercut and rolled fillets. And to help reduce stress, the crankshaft is internally balanced.
High-flow cast-aluminum cylinder heads that feature a low-friction roller-rocker valvetrain
Electronic Throttle Control to help achieve optimum vehicle performance and efficiency
A Powertrain Control Module that continuously measures input to achieve optimized engine performance and smooth transmission shifts
Coil-near-plug ignition system for a precise delivery of high-energy spark
